Updated on 8/3/2026

Ethos Technologies (LIFE) stock has gained about 30% since 4/30/2026 because of the following key factors:

1. Exceptional Fiscal Q2 2026 Financial Results and Raised Full-Year Guidance. Ethos Technologies reported strong results for its fiscal second quarter ended June 30, 2026, with revenue of $189.6 million, significantly exceeding FactSet estimates of $117.3 million and marking a 113% year-over-year increase. The company also achieved a diluted GAAP EPS of $0.30, surpassing the estimated $0.05. Following these results, Ethos raised its full-year fiscal 2026 revenue guidance to a range of $727 million to $731 million, a substantial increase from previous estimates and implying an 88% year-over-year growth at the midpoint.

2. Strategic Partnerships and AI-Driven Product Innovation. Ethos expanded its market reach through significant strategic initiatives, including a partnership with Liberty Mutual, which will white-label Ethos's digital underwriting and life insurance platform. Additionally, the company launched a native ChatGPT-based app in early May 2026, enabling users to receive personalized term life insurance estimates and explore coverage up to $3 million, highlighting its embrace of artificial intelligence for customer acquisition. The company also initiated brand partnerships with public figures like David Ortiz in May 2026 and Amanda Kloots in July 2026 to enhance public awareness and trust in its digital life insurance offerings.

3. Increased Analyst Confidence and Elevated Price Targets. A notable factor contributing to the stock's positive trend was the series of analyst upgrades and raised price targets. During the specified period, firms such as Citizens, Barclays, and J.P. Morgan increased their price targets for LIFE stock. For instance, Citizens raised its target from $21.00 to $27.00 in May 2026, and Barclays increased its target from $20.00 to $27.00, also in May 2026. J.P. Morgan further raised its price target from $22.00 to $23.00 in July 2026. The average analyst price target in the three months leading up to the analysis was $26.83, reflecting a 31.41% potential upside from the stock's price of $20.42.

4. Share Repurchase Authorization. The company's board of directors authorized a share repurchase program of up to $100 million of its Class A common stock. This move demonstrates management's confidence in the company's valuation and financial health, which can positively impact shareholder value by reducing the outstanding share count.

About Ethos Technologies (LIFE)

Ethos Technologies (symbol: LIFE) operates a three-sided technology platform dedicated to modernizing and democratizing access to life insurance. The company tackles the persistent challenges within the traditional life insurance sector, where consumers face slow and complex processes, agents grapple with disparate technologies and lengthy sales cycles, and carriers rely on outdated, analog underwriting. Ethos’s mission is to transform the entire experience of buying, selling, and managing life insurance.

The company provides distinct value propositions to each of its primary constituents. For consumers, Ethos offers a 100% digital application and underwriting process, featuring transparent pricing, a few health questions powered by its proprietary engine, and rapid policy decisions, often in minutes, without the need for medical exams. Agents are equipped with an all-in-one Agent Operating System (Agent OS) that streamlines quoting, application submissions, policy management, and payments, significantly increasing their time available for sales. Carriers benefit by expanding their market reach and optimizing risk selection and profitability, with Ethos explicitly stating it does not assume balance sheet risk for the policies on its platform.

Ethos Technologies serves the extensive U.S. life insurance market, connecting a growing ecosystem of consumers, agents, and carriers. The company has demonstrated substantial growth, having activated over 500,000 policies since inception. As of September 30, 2025, its platform supported over 10,000 active selling agents and several active carriers, leveraging strong network effects to drive its continued expansion within the financial security industry.

The major customers of Ethos Technologies (symbol: LIFE) are life insurance carriers.

Ethos operates a three-sided technology platform that provides significant value to consumers, agents, and carriers. However, its primary business model and customer relationship are with the life insurance carriers. Ethos helps these carriers expand their consumer and agent reach, optimize risk selection, and improve profitability through its digital application and underwriting technology. Ethos explicitly states that it does not assume balance sheet risk for the policies on its platform, indicating that the carriers are the entities issuing the policies and taking on the financial risk, making them the direct recipients of Ethos's technology and services.

Peter Colis - Co-Founder, CEO Prior to co-founding Ethos to make life insurance more accessible and affordable, Peter Colis was the CEO of Ovid Corp., an insurance auction platform that was acquired in 2019. He co-founded Ethos with Lingke Wang in 2016. Chris Capozzi - Chief Financial Officer Chris Capozzi leads Finance, Legal, and Human Resources at Ethos. He previously held executive leadership positions including Partner and CFO at Quiet Capital, COO and CFO at Achieve, and Chief Risk Officer at General Electric. Lingke Wang - Co-founder, President As Co-founder and President of Ethos, Lingke Wang oversees the technology and insurance teams. He co-founded Ethos with Peter Colis in 2016 and was also a co-founder of Ovid Corp. Vipul Sharma - Chief Technology Officer Vipul Sharma has served as Chief Technology Officer at Ethos since July 2021. Erin Lantz - Chief Revenue Officer Erin Lantz brings years of experience building and scaling businesses at leading real estate and financial services organizations, including Zillow Group and BofA.

Ethos Technologies (symbol: LIFE) faces several key risks inherent to its business model and the industry it operates within:

  1. Reliance on Carrier Partnerships and the Efficacy of its Proprietary Underwriting Engine: Ethos's core business relies on its ability to partner with and retain life insurance carriers, as it does not assume the balance sheet risk of the policies on its platform. Its value proposition to these carriers hinges on optimizing risk selection and profitability, which is driven by its proprietary underwriting engine and digital processes that provide decisions in minutes. A significant risk is that carriers may lose confidence in the accuracy or effectiveness of Ethos's underwriting engine, leading to higher-than-expected claims or a perception of suboptimal risk selection. Such a development, or the termination of partnerships for other reasons, could severely impact Ethos's ability to facilitate policy sales and generate revenue.
  2. Competition and Market Adoption in a Traditionally Analog Industry: Ethos aims to transform a life insurance market characterized by slow, complex, and opaque processes, where technology has not significantly improved the experience for decades. While the company offers a 100% digital application and underwriting process, it faces the ongoing challenge of widespread market adoption by consumers and agents who may be resistant to change. Despite the acknowledged need for life insurance, a significant portion of American adults still do not purchase it due to factors like perceived complexity and cost. Ethos could also face increasing competition from existing legacy carriers that modernize their own technology platforms or from new entrants with similar disruptive models, potentially limiting its growth and market share.

The addressable market for Ethos Technologies' main product, life insurance, is the United States life insurance market. This market was estimated to be approximately USD 1.93 trillion in 2024. It is projected to grow to around USD 4.74 trillion by 2034,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 9.40% from 2025 to 2034. Ethos Technologies targets the U.S. market, where a significant need for a new approach to life insurance exists. In 2024, 42% of American adults recognized their need for life insurance but did not purchase it due to factors such as product complexity and perceived cost. An estimated 102 million adults in the U.S. are uninsured or underinsured and acknowledge a need for greater life insurance coverage. This includes 50 million middle-income Americans with a coverage gap and 54 million women reporting insufficient coverage. Households earning less than US$50,000 annually are also highly likely to express a need for life insurance.

Ethos Technologies (symbol: LIFE) is expected to drive future revenue growth over the next 2-3 years through several key strategies:

  1. Expansion of its Agent and Consumer Network: Ethos aims to scale its network of active selling agents and consumers to increase activated policies and market penetration. As of September 30, 2025, the company had over 10,000 active selling agents and had activated over 500,000 policies, with management emphasizing continued growth in both these channels.
  2. Continuous Platform Innovation and AI/Machine Learning Integration: The company plans to continuously innovate its platform to enhance risk management, agent tools, and the overall customer experience. Management has specifically highlighted artificial intelligence (AI) as a core driver of future growth and efficiency, particularly in distribution, underwriting, and operations.
  3. Expansion of Carrier Partnerships and Product Portfolio: Ethos intends to build strategic partnerships with additional carriers and expand its product offerings. Recent examples include launching an accumulation indexed universal life product and a cancer insurance product with new partners. This strategy aims to broaden the addressable market and increase average revenue per user.
  4. Strategic Mergers & Acquisitions (M&A): Ethos' growth strategy also includes potential acquisitions or investments in complementary businesses, products, or technologies, with IPO proceeds providing flexibility for such opportunistic M&A activities.

Share Issuance

  • Ethos Technologies Inc. made its public debut on the NASDAQ on January 29, 2026, by offering 10.5 million shares at $19 each.
  • The company's Initial Public Offering (IPO) raised a total of $200 million.
  • Ethos Technologies received approximately $97 million in gross proceeds from the sale of its shares in the IPO.

Inbound Investments

  • In July 2021, Ethos raised $100 million in its Series D-1 funding round, achieving a post-money valuation of $2.7 billion.
  • Prior to its IPO, Ethos Technologies had raised a total of $416 million in venture funding.
  • Significant investors in the company have included Sequoia Capital, Accel, GV (Alphabet's venture arm), SoftBank, and General Catalyst.
